How fast do homes sell in Matteson?
Over the past year, homes in Matteson have gone under contract in around six weeks on average (48 days), with the typical home closing in about 27 days.

Is now a good time to sell in Matteson?
With 54 homes for sale against 196 sales a year, about 3.3 months of supply, Matteson is a seller's market. Sellers here have been getting about 99.5% of list price.
